Top US Exchange-Traded Funds for Balanced Investment

Building a robust investment portfolio doesn't demand complex strategies. Several US-listed Exchange-Traded Funds offer excellent distribution across various market classes. For example, consider all-cap market Exchange-Traded Funds like VTI or ITOT, which offer exposure to the whole US stock landscape. Alternatively, carefully planned investors could explore benchmark Exchange-Traded Funds that combine US stocks with international allocations, such as VT or ACWI. These products allow individuals to efficiently reach a diversified approach without needing to manually pick individual stocks. Remember to consistently assess your investments and consider your personal tolerance before making any investment choices.
